What Is a Civil Rights Lawsuit?

Under the 1871 Civil Rights Act, which is codified in federal law under 42 U.S.C. § 1983, people can sue the government for violations of their civil rights.  Civil rights lawsuits are commonly called Section 1983 lawsuits, which is a reference to the federal law.

What Is Malicious Prosecution?

Malicious prosecution is a type of claim in a civil rights lawsuit. The claim is that a member of law enforcement like a police officer wrongly deprived a person of his or her Fourteenth Amendment right to liberty.
